Senior Building Automation Technician Responsibilities: Responsible for the execution/installation of building automation projects. Develops and executes small retrofit and upgrade projects, while maintaining a universal technical knowledge and the ability to troubleshoot BMS/BAS service-related calls. Demonstrates knowledge in the commercial HVAC sequence of operation, basic computer knowledge, and building construction operations. Responsible for system designs, installation, programming, commissioning, and operational verification. Works with a Field Supervisor and Project Manager to schedule and complete tasks in a timely manner. Mentors and teaches other technicians. Follow safety requirements as outlined GUNTHERS. Maintain complete and accurate documentation of services performed and generates reports Provides exceptional customer service. Completes any additional tasks as outlined by supervisors. Senior Building Automation Technician Qualifications: 5+ years of experience required. Expert with Commercial Heating Ventilation and Air Conditioning (HVAC) systems including the various components and processes. (Service background preferred). Proficient understanding of computers, electronics, and electrical circuits and how they work together. Knowledge of building automation systems, PLCs, HVAC, electrical concepts, and building operations. Engineering and programming (PLC or BMS) background helpful. Tridium N4 Certification Preferred.
